Postfix 无法向 Gmail 发送邮件 - 发件人未送达通知

Postfix 无法向 Gmail 发送邮件 - 发件人未送达通知

使用 Postfix 向 Gmail 发送邮件时遇到一些问题。以下是我的日志:

Nov 24 15:07:02 ubuntu-4gb-fsn1-1 postfix/pickup[101539]: 4C99C4225A: uid=33 from=<www-data>
Nov 24 15:07:02 ubuntu-4gb-fsn1-1 postfix/cleanup[101916]: 4C99C4225A: message-id=<20201124140702.4C99C4225A@ubuntu-4gb-fsn1-1>
Nov 24 15:07:02 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 4C99C4225A: from=<[email protected]>, size=329, nrcpt=1 (queue active)
Nov 24 15:07:03 ubuntu-4gb-fsn1-1 postfix/smtp[101918]: 4C99C4225A: to=<[email protected]>, relay=mx-eu.mail.am0.yahoodns.net[188.125.72.74]:25, d
elay=0.91, delays=0.02/0.01/0.34/0.52, dsn=2.0.0, status=sent (250 ok dirdel)
Nov 24 15:07:03 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 4C99C4225A: removed
Nov 24 15:07:58 ubuntu-4gb-fsn1-1 postfix/pickup[101539]: 9552D4225A: uid=33 from=<www-data>
Nov 24 15:07:58 ubuntu-4gb-fsn1-1 postfix/cleanup[101916]: 9552D4225A: message-id=<20201124140758.9552D4225A@ubuntu-4gb-fsn1-1>
Nov 24 15:07:58 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 9552D4225A: from=<[email protected]>, size=332, nrcpt=1 (queue active)
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/smtp[101918]: 9552D4225A: to=<[email protected]>, relay=gmail-smtp-in.l.google.com[2a00:1450:400c:c0c::1b]:25, delay=0.76, delays=0.01/0/0.13/0.61, dsn=5.7.1, status=bounced (host gmail-smtp-in.l.google.com[2a00:1450:400c:c0c::1b] said: 550-5.7.1 [2a01:4f8:c010:3127::1] Our system has detected that this message does 550-5.7.1 not meet IPv6 sending guidelines regarding PTR records and 550-5.7.1 authentication. Please review 550-5.7.1  https://support.google.com/mail/?p=IPv6AuthError for more information 550 5.7.1 . n11si2614598wma.157 - gsmtp (in reply to end of DATA command))
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/cleanup[101916]: 5B1304225D: message-id=<20201124140759.5B1304225D@ubuntu-4gb-fsn1-1>
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/bounce[101930]: 9552D4225A: sender non-delivery notification: 5B1304225D
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 5B1304225D: from=<>, size=3011, nrcpt=1 (queue active)
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 9552D4225A: removed
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/local[101931]: 5B1304225D: to=<[email protected]>, relay=local, delay=0.01, delays=0/0.01/0/0, dsn=2.0.0, status=sent (delivered to mailbox)
Nov 24 15:07:59 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 5B1304225D: removed
Nov 24 15:20:21 ubuntu-4gb-fsn1-1 postfix/pickup[101539]: 714A94225D: uid=33 from=<www-data>
Nov 24 15:20:21 ubuntu-4gb-fsn1-1 postfix/cleanup[102121]: 714A94225D: message-id=<20201124142021.714A94225D@ubuntu-4gb-fsn1-1>
Nov 24 15:20:21 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 714A94225D: from=<[email protected]>, size=328, nrcpt=1 (queue active)
Nov 24 15:20:21 ubuntu-4gb-fsn1-1 postfix/smtp[102123]: 714A94225D: host mx1.pub.mailpod9-cph3.one.com[185.164.14.118] said: 450 4.7.1 138.119.249.183 temporary greylisted by CYREN IP reputation (in reply to MAIL FROM command)
Nov 24 15:20:21 ubuntu-4gb-fsn1-1 postfix/smtp[102123]: 714A94225D: lost connection with mx1.pub.mailpod9-cph3.one.com[185.164.14.118] while sending RCPT TO
Nov 24 15:20:22 ubuntu-4gb-fsn1-1 postfix/smtp[102123]: 714A94225D: to=<[email protected]>, relay=mx3.pub.mailpod9-cph3.one.com[185.164.14.120]:25, delay=0.92, delays=0.02/0.02/0.82/0.07, dsn=4.7.1, status=deferred (host mx3.pub.mailpod9-cph3.one.com[185.164.14.120] said: 450 4.7.1 138.119.249.183 temporary greylisted by CYREN IP reputation (in reply to MAIL FROM command))
Nov 24 15:27:09 ubuntu-4gb-fsn1-1 postfix/qmgr[65515]: 714A94225D: from=<[email protected]>, size=328, nrcpt=1 (queue active)
Nov 24 15:27:10 ubuntu-4gb-fsn1-1 postfix/smtp[102169]: 714A94225D: host mx3.pub.mailpod9-cph3.one.com[185.164.14.120] said: 450 4.7.1 138.119.249.183 temporary greylisted by CYREN IP reputation (in reply to MAIL FROM command)

Nov 24 15:27:10 ubuntu-4gb-fsn1-1 postfix/smtp[102169]: 714A94225D: lost connection with mx3.pub.mailpod9-cph3.one.com[185.164.14.120] while sending RCPT TO
Nov 24 15:27:10 ubuntu-4gb-fsn1-1 postfix/smtp[102169]: 714A94225D: to=<[email protected]>, relay=mx2.pub.mailpod9-cph3.one.com[185.164.14.119]:25, delay=409, delays=408/0.02/0.57/0.05, dsn=4.7.1, status=deferred (host mx2.pub.mailpod9-cph3.one.com[185.164.14.119] said: 450 4.7.1 138.119.249.183 temporary greylisted by CYREN IP reputation (in reply to MAIL FROM command))
(END)

您可以看到,yahoo 没有问题。但是sender non-delivery notificationgmail 却出现了问题。

知道原因吗?

我的 Postfix 配置:

smtpd_banner = $myhostname ESMTP $mail_name (Ubuntu)
biff = no

# appending .domain is the MUA's job.
append_dot_mydomain = no

# Uncomment the next line to generate "delayed mail" warnings
#delay_warning_time = 4h

readme_directory = no

# See http://www.postfix.org/COMPATIBILITY_README.html -- default to 2 on
# fresh installs.
compatibility_level = 2

# TLS parameters
smtpd_tls_cert_file=/etc/ssl/certs/ssl-cert-snakeoil.pem
smtpd_tls_key_file=/etc/ssl/private/ssl-cert-snakeoil.key
smtpd_tls_security_level=may

smtp_tls_CApath=/etc/ssl/certs
smtp_tls_security_level=may
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ache

smtpd_relay_restrictions = permit_mynetworks permit_sasl_authenticated defer_unauth_destination
myhostname = ubuntu-4gb-fsn1-1
alias_maps = hash:/etc/aliases
alias_database = hash:/etc/aliases
myorigin = /etc/mailname
mydestination = my-domain.com, $myhostname, ubuntu-4gb-fsn1-1, localhost.localdomain, localhost
relayhost =
m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128
mailbox_size_limit = 0
recipient_delimiter = +
inet_interfaces = loopback-only
inet_protocols = all

答案1

Google 的退回邮件已经充分解释了原因:

550-5.7.1 [2a01:4f8:c010:3127::1] 我们的系统检测到此邮件不符合有关 PTR 记录和 550-5.7.1 身份验证的 IPv6 发送指南。请检查 550-5.7.1 https://support.google.com/mail/?p=IPv6AuthError了解更多信息

因此,您必须阅读指定 URL 中的信息并按照那里的指定配置您的邮件服务器。

还请注意,其他接收主机正在告诉您:450 4.7.1 138.119.249.183 临时被 CYREN IP 信誉列入灰名单。您的服务器 IP 在某个名为 CYREN 的服务中被标记为“信誉不佳”(抱歉,我不知道它是什么 - 您必须自己查找)。您可能还需要解决此问题才能将您的邮件递送到 Google,因为 Google 对“信誉不佳”的 IP 非常敏感。

相关内容